I think only Gskill is a problem on that boarD (I have not had a problem though)


If you are getting that board, make sure you are getting a Black Edition CPU though since the setting for HT Link multiplier is broken and there is no ETA on a bios fix for it (I contatced tech support and they directed me to an overclocking website)
